CLAT PG 2024: Complete Question Paper Analysis

From an increase in the number of passages to a more time-consuming format, this year's CLAT PG brought some surprises. On 3 December 2023, The Common Law Admission Test for Post-Graduate Studies (CLAT LLM) was conducted for the academic year 2024-25. With an impressive 93.92% of registered students taking the exam, the excitement was high, and the stakes were raised. However, some students struggled with longer questions, making it hard to complete the entire paper.

Section 498-A IPC: Law against Cruelty towards Women

In a society where marriages are highly valued, Section 498-A of IPC both harms & protects. It addresses the issue of domestic violence, dowry harassment & gender equality but also raises concerns about justice and societal expectations like the arrest of an accused without investigation on a mere complaint, fake FIRs & impact on family relationships. Nearly 31,000 complaints of crimes committed against women had been received by the National Commission for Women (NCW) in 2022, the highest since 2014. Shocking!

Section 304A IPC: Laws on Medical Negligence in India

Medical negligence is the breach of a duty of care owed by healthcare professionals to their patients, resulting in harm or injury due to a failure to meet the standard of care expected in the medical field.
